About NE46 3DT

NE46 3DT scores 88/100 on the NestScope Score, with its strongest showing in local amenities and schools — with Co-op Hexham West Street about 4 minutes' walk away. The breakdown below draws on official UK data covering schools, safety, healthcare, transport, environment and local amenities.

In national context, NE46 3DT is one of the most affluent neighbourhoods in England — IMD decile 10/10, ranked 30,806 of 32,844 neighbourhoods in England. The Index of Multiple Deprivation is the UK government's official measure of relative deprivation, refreshed roughly every five years. Housing pressure here is moderate (IMD housing decile 6/10).

There are 8 schools within the typical catchment area, including 1 rated Outstanding by Ofsted and 7 rated Good. The nearest school is The Sele First School (Ofsted: Good), about 4 minutes' walk away.

There were 5 crimes reported on the surrounding streets in the most recent month, indicating a very low level of immediate-area crime.

Healthcare access is good, with 2 GP surgeries, 1 hospital and 6 dental practices in the wider neighbourhood. The nearest GP practice is BURN BRAE MEDICAL GROUP, 0.7 mi away. The nearest hospital is HEXHAM GENERAL HOSPITAL, about 13 minutes' walk away. A pharmacy is about 8 minutes' walk away.
